Birds grabbing a slice of Pie

The Baltimore Orioles have picked up former hyped center field prospect Felix Pie from the Chicago Cubs for starter Garrett Olson and minor league pitcher Hank Williamson. Pie needed to be dealt because after six seasons, you stop being a “prospect” and start being the guy who couldn’t make the major league roster. His days were numbered after this past season – when your team chooses to stick a corner outfielder who couldn’t make the Blue Jays 25-man roster (Reed Johnson) in center, then after realizing that was a bad idea chooses to reanimate the corpse of Jim Edmonds rather than give you another shot in center, you’re never going to make it.
